If you re a person who wants to be fit, here are some suggestions for you.

英语选修7unit2单元测试题

1. Get to know yourself well.

You should know what the right weight is for your age, height, and body type. You can check with your parents or with a doctor. Only by knowing enough about yourself can you make a suitable fitness plan for yourself.

2. Eat a variety of foods, especially fruits and vegetables.

You may have a favorite food, but it is best to eat a variety of foods. If you eat different kinds of foods, you re more likely to _______________ your body needs.

3. Drink water and milk more often.

When you re really thirsty, water is the No.1 thirst quencher. Try to limit the intake of sugary soft drinks, like sodas and juice cocktails. They contain a lot of added sugar. Also you need calcium to grow strong bones, and milk is a great source of this mineral. Two cups of milk (about half a liter) will work for you each day.

4. Limit screen time.

What s screen time? It s the amount of time you spend watching TV, DVDs and videos, playing hand-held computer games and using the computer. Try to spend no more than 2 hours a day on screen time. Don t be a couch potato.

5. Be active.

You should figure out which activities you like best. Boys may be more interested in ball games, or maybe have a passion for karate and things like that. Girls may like dancing; nowadays yoga has become more and more popular among females of all ages.
